Is this guidance up to date? … Weblipid profile to measure LDL-C. Use the Simon Broome or Dutch Lipid Clinic Network (DLCN) criteria to make a clinical diagnosis of FH. Refer to Lipid Clinic for further assessment if clinical diagnosis of FH or if TC>9.0mmol/L and/or LDL-C >6.5mmol/L and/or non -HDL C … sims 4 high school years hair cc https://aweb2see.com

WebJan 19, 2024 · INTRODUCTION. Because lipids, such as cholesterol and triglycerides, are insoluble in water these lipids must be transported in association with proteins (lipoproteins) in the circulation. For statin intolerance or as add on … sims 4 high school years gameplayWebSep 16, 2024 · Lipids are crucial components of cellular function owing to their role in membrane formation, intercellular signaling, energy storage, and homeostasis maintenance. In the brain, lipid dysregulations have been associated with the etiology and progression of neurodegeneration and other neurological pathologies. Washington, Gerald Van Hoosier, in The Laboratory Rabbit, Guinea Pig, Hamster, and Other Rodents, 2012 Lipid Metabolism Cholesterol. The reference range for cholesterol concentration in the gerbil is 90–150 mg/dl (Table 3.2)..
